An Inverter turns DC mains into AC one, at a constant output frequency.
Direct Current input
Input voltage may come from different sources, i.e. solar panels, batteries, rectifiers, busbars, etc. Usually this voltage is variable, because these power sources works in very variable conditions. So JEMA’s inverter is design to admit an input voltage wide variation, while keeping the requested output parameters levels.
Transference by-pass
Ondulators works on-line and they are usually equipped with a static by-pass to be able, in an emergency case, to transfer to an auxiliary mains. Also they have a manual one for maintenance.
UNIT DESIGN
Excellent dynamic behaviour unit, with IGBT transistors. One microprocessor control manages the system considering the received signals and orders, and informs the user about its status. It also carries out the synchronisation with the auxiliary main, in units that add a by-pass. Control functions:
- historic: 250 last alarms displayed, with date and time
- automatic control: programmable start-up and shut down
- diagnosis: unit status is displayed and transmitted
- measures: •Vef and Ief of all phases
•active, apparent and reactive powers
•internal temperatures
•efficiency, power factor and frequency
- test: automatic, local/remote, periodical and programmable
- digital adjust: adjustable parameters by keyboard
- configurable: adjustable system basic functions
- help: it provides help for the keyboard use

SPECIFICATIONS (generic, to detail for each case)
Input 24 / 48 / 110 / 125 / 220 VDC
Voltage margin according to design
Output From 1 to 1300 kVA
Single-phase 220 VAC, ± 1 %
Three-phase 220 / 380 / 400 VAC, ± 1 %
Voltage adjustment ± 5% Vn
Frequency 50 / 60 / 400 Hz, ± 0,1 %
Admissible cos φ 0.6 capacitive / 0.4 inductive
First harmonic 3%
Max. global THD dist. with linear load < 3 %
no linear load < 5 %
Dynamic response ± 5 %
Response time 30 ms
Crest factor 3
Efficiency 80 – 93 %, according to power
